1. Game 1 My trip starts at Giants Stadium

Finally had a breather on the bus towards the Giants Stadium. Everyone on the bus was really supportive of the trip and they even filled out a bunch of questionaires already. Some have been lifelong Giants fans and it was really interesting riding the bus with these guys.

It took a little while to get to the stadium as there was traffice and we parked up with only minutes before kick off. Thankfully we took a few shots with the banner outside the stadium. Sadly the Giants Stadium told me I could not take my poster/card into the grouds which was a shame as I thought it could help me meet fans and get exposure. Oh well.

 

We took our seats in section 335 wearing the t-shirts and we got some great pictures and many of the fans were really supportive. It was good atmosphere and a beautiful stadium. The crowd took a little while to get into the game, but really the Redskins vaguely showed up and played very safe football. Once the Giants scored early with an Eli Manning making a run, they also played conservative football in order to get their first wion of the season.

 

I was not able to do much tailgating at the this game, but the coach was a great substitute for that. After the game  I met some more fans and they were really fun and everyone carried on driking and being really supportive. It was a great night and it was good to see the home team wion on my first game.!

Pre-game

For a few seasons now the Superbowl winning team, has hosted the following NFL season opener. After the Giant's "David over Goliath" win in last year's Super Bowl, they will be hosting the Washington Redskins. I saw the Giants play in London last season against the Dolphins and both teams had good support. Though because the Giants have won the Superbowl, I think the crowd are really going to get behind their team more than ever. I'm looking forward to kickstarting the trip with such an historic rivalry with both teams being in the same division. I have been to a Giants pre-eason game before,and it was a lot of fun, but the opening the season really will be amazing!
